STILL ON THE ROAD 1996 SUMMER TOUR OF EUROPE JUNE 15 Århus, Denmark Århus Festival, Tangkrogen 17 Berlin, Germany Tempodrom 19 Frankfurt, Germany Alte Oper 20 Utrecht, Holland Muziekcentrum Vredenburg 21 Utrecht, Holland Muziekcentrum Vredenburg 22 Brussels, Belgium Vorst Nationaal 24 Differdange, Luxembourg Hall Omnisports 26 Liverpool, England Empire 27 Liverpool, England Empire 29 London, England Hyde Park JULY 1 Münster, Germany Halle Münsterland 2 Mannheim, Germany Mozartsaal im Rosengarten 3 Konstanz, Germany Zeltfestival 5 Ferrara, Italy Piazza Castello 7 Pistoia, Italy Pistoia Blues Festival, Piazza Duomo 8 Passariano, Italy Villa Manin 9 Salzburg, Austria Sporthalle Alpenstrasse 10 Tambach, Germany Schloss Tambach 12 Magdeburg, Germany Stadthalle 13 Hamburg, Germany Bahrenfeld-Trabrennbahn 14 Cottbus, Germany Stadthalle 18 Oslo, Norway Spektrum 19 Molde, Norway Molde Jazz Festival, Romsdalsmuséet 21 Pori, Finland 31st International Pori Jazz Festival, Kirjurinluoto 23 Copenhagen, Denmark Den Grå Hal, Fristaden Christiania 24 Copenhagen, Denmark Den Grå Hal, Fristaden Christiania 25 Malmö, Sweden Slottsmöllan 27 Stockholm, Sweden Lollipop Festival, Lida Friluftsgård, Tullinge AUGUST 3 Atlanta, Georgia House Of Blues 4 Atlanta, Georgia House Of Blues

17260 Tangkrogen Århus, Denmark 15 June 1996 Århus Festival. 1. The New Minglewood Blues (adapted from "Minglewood Blues" by Noah Lewis) 2. Pretty Peggy-O (trad. arr. Bob Dylan) 4. Positively 4th Street 5. Silvio (Bob Dylan & Robert Hunter) 6. Mr. Tambourine Man 7. Masters Of War 8. Don't Think Twice, It's All Right 9. Friend Of The Devil (Jerry Garcia - Robert Hunter - John Dawson) 10. Highway 61 Revisited 11. Girl From The North Country 12. Rainy Day Women # 12 & 35 Concert # 785 of The Never-Ending Tour. First concert of the 1996 Europe Summer Tour. 1996 concert # 29. Concert # 329 with the 9th Never-Ending Tour Band: Bob Dylan (vocal & guitar), Bucky Baxter (pedal steel guitar & 6-9, 11 acoustic with the band. 6, 11 Bob Dylan harmonica. 1, 5, 9, 12 John Jackson, Bucky Baxter (backup vocals). Note. Live debut of New Minglewood Blues. Stereo audience recording, 90 minutes. Session info updated 6 August 1997.

17350 Hyde Park London, England 29 June 1996 MasterCard Masters of Music Concert for The Prince's Trust. 1. Leopard-Skin Pill-Box Hat 2. All Along The Watchtower 3. Positively 4th Street 4. Just Like Tom Thumb's Blues 5. Tangled Up In Blue 6. Don't Think Twice, It's All Right 7. Silvio (Bob Dylan & Robert Hunter) 8. Seven Days 9. Highway 61 Revisited Concert # 794 of The Never-Ending Tour. Concert # 10 of the 1996 Europe Summer Tour. 1996 concert # 38. Concert # 338 with the 9th Never-Ending Tour Band: Bob Dylan (vocal & guitar), Bucky Baxter (pedal steel guitar & Al Kooper (organ), Ron Wood (electric guitar). 8 Ron Wood (shared vocal). 9 Ron Wood (electric slide guitar). 5, 6 acoustic with the band. 1, 5 Bob Dylan harmonica. 7, 8 John Jackson, Bucky Baxter (backup vocals). Notes 1, 4 and 7 broadcast by various European TV stations, July and August 1996. 1, 3, 4, 7 and 9 broadcast by HBO in USA, August 1996. Part of 5 broadcast by BBC2 TV, 29 May 1997 in Newsnight in a feature on Bob Dylan s illness. 4 new songs (44%) compared to previous concert. No new songs for this tour. 1, 3, 4, 7 and 9 stereo TV recording. Stereo audience recording, 65 minutes. Session info updated 21 November 2015.
